1.心跳包如何发送: 主要是客户机发送给服务器,服务器接收到后,再回复。 //之前做的项目,WPF与U3D进行通信,WPF端是处于监听端,而U3D属于客户端,不断的发心跳包给WPF //WPF端代码如下: //嵌入U3D窗口 void initU3D() { //将Exehost 控件添加到 Win ...
分类:
数据库 时间:
2017-07-08 17:44:25
阅读次数:
251
iOS 的自动登录 就是 先要用户名和密码 登入成功 后 保存到本地的数据库中 然后下次打开的程序的时候 直接取出本地数据库中的用户名和密码 iOS登录及token的业务逻辑 登录的业务逻辑 { http:是短连接. 服务器如何判断当前用户是否登录? // 1. 如果是即时通信类:长连接. // 如 ...
分类:
移动开发 时间:
2017-06-23 00:47:41
阅读次数:
291
Android开发中,alarmManager在5.0以上系统,启动时间设置无效的问题 做一个app,需要后台保持发送心跳包。由于锁屏后CPU休眠,导致心跳包线程被挂起,所以尝试使用alarmManager定时唤醒Service发送心跳包。以下是开启alarmManager的代码 做一个app,需要 ...
分类:
移动开发 时间:
2017-06-19 12:46:13
阅读次数:
398
监控主动轮询进程是否会崩溃跪掉,采取措施是通过心跳包形式进行抓取,定时生成文件,jnotify监听发到kafka上,之后通过消费者进行解析,若发现不符规则情况,发邮件短信报警。 Java代码 package heartbeat.monitor; import java.io.FileInputStr ...
分类:
其他好文 时间:
2017-05-17 11:59:55
阅读次数:
290
一、什么是长连接 一、什么是长连接 HTTP1.1规定了默认保持长连接(HTTP persistent connection ,也有翻译为持久连接),数据传输完成了保持TCP连接不断开(不发RST包、不四次握手),等待在同域名下继续用这个通道传输数据;相反的就是短连接。 HTTP首部的Connect ...
分类:
其他好文 时间:
2017-04-12 13:43:59
阅读次数:
1084
1. 基于GPRS的远程控制测试 网关板载GPRS模块,可以与任何具有已知外网IP,或由已知外网IP映射的端口进行数据通信。通信过程由GPRS发起,连接远程IP,然后进行TCP/IP数据通信。网关设备采用心跳包保持永久在线、支持断线自动重连。第一次连接或者掉线后再次重连,网关向服务器发送初始包,6个 ...
分类:
其他好文 时间:
2017-04-06 01:32:31
阅读次数:
384
http://itindex.net/detail/52922-%E5%BF%83%E8%B7%B3-heartbeat-coderzh 几乎所有的网游服务端都有心跳包(HeartBeat或Ping)的设计,在最近开发手游服务端时,也用到了心跳包。思考思考,心跳包是必须的吗?为什么需要心跳包?TCP ...
分类:
其他好文 时间:
2017-03-31 18:14:35
阅读次数:
246
socket 客户端 的一些想法 包头 4byte 4byte 2byte 2byte 数据长 数据长 690 0 1.登录 2.每隔15秒发送心跳包 3.死循环接收数据,把收到的byte[]塞到List<byte>(队列,先进先出)(生产者) 4.List<byte> 要有同步锁 5.死循环读取L ...
分类:
其他好文 时间:
2017-03-20 17:03:17
阅读次数:
175
keepalived即健康检查,不停的发送心跳包检查nginx是否活着。Nginx至少两台,一主一备。 ...
分类:
其他好文 时间:
2017-02-21 22:31:07
阅读次数:
221